Norenberg & Associates Salary

As of August 2026, the average annual salary for employees at Norenberg & Associates in the United States is $78,741.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$38. Salaries at Norenberg & Associates typically range from $69,203 to $89,089 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Minneapolis?

Understanding the cost of living near Minneapolis is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Norenberg & Associates.
Minneapolis' Cost of Living Index is approximately 104.8 (4.8% more expensive than US average; 7.9% more than MN average). Major city, vibrant, housing costs above US avg, cold winters (high heating). Metro Transit. When planning your budget based on a salary from Norenberg & Associates,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,400 - $2,100+ A significant portion of Norenberg & Associates sal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$130 - $230 (Heating significant)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$120 (Metro Transit mon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$430 - $630 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$450 - $800+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$390 - $720+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,920 - $4,480+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
